SESSION 1: LOVE AND THE RIGHT PERSON

This must be the most asked question out there in the dating world, "Is He/She the right person for me?" but during this session, we were taught about how there's no such thing as the right person out there. It's just a myth. Instead, the reality is we should become the right person first. Because when you become the person you're looking for is looking for, naturally, the same energies will gravitate towards each other. You'll just be shocked that he/she will just come around when you least expect it.

But we have to understand that we need to make sure that what we do now in our life will bring us closer to where we want to be in the future. As what Pastor Mel said during the talk; "The present will be your past, but it will be present in your future." I really agree with this statement because a lot of our past experiences, whether we like them or not, will really stay with us as we grow old. So before anyone of us would do anything drastic in our lives, we must think about it a lot of times so that we won't regret it in the end. The behavior of the right person when it comes to loving is best described in 1 Corinthians 13: 4-7 "Love is patient, kind, without envy. It is not boastful or arrogant. It is not ill-mannered nor does it seek its own interest. Love overcomes anger and forgets offenses. It does not take delight in wrong, but rejoices in truth. Love excuses everything, believes all things, hopes all things, endures all things."

SESSION 3: DESIGNER SEX
"How can you give all of you, when you have already given away parts of you?"

This session talked about God's design for sex in the context of marriage, and how people should view sexuality. Nowadays, with all the things that the media has been feeding us, we have to remind ourselves that to treat sexuality as just physical is to just hurt ourselves and others. We have to remember that our body is the temple of God and that God's design for sex is : Intimacy, which is to know and be fully known. But Intimacy does not come without responsibility. 1 Corinthians 6:19-20 "Do you not know that your bodies are temples of the Holy Spirit, within you given by God? You belong no longer to yourselves. Remember at what price you have been bought and make your body serve the glory of God."  Having this in mind, we must flee from sexual immorality, and instead grow intimate with our Lord through reading his word.
